CMOS 8-bit Single Chip Microcomputer
Description
The CXP832P40A is a CMOS 8-bit single chip
microcomputer integrating on a single chip an A/D
converter, serial interface, timer/counter, time base
timer, 32kHz timer/counter, capture timer counter,
LCD controller/driver, remote control reception
circuit and 14-bit PWM output besides the basic
configurations of 8-bit CPU, PROM, RAM, and I/O port.
Also the CXP832P40A provides sleep/stop function
which enables to lower power consumption.
The CXP832P40A is the PROM-incorporated
version of the CXP83240A with built-in mask ROM.
This provides the additional feature of being able to
